The Pashtun of United States

The Pashtun of United States, numbering approximately 24,500 people, are Engaged yet Unreached. They are an Eastern Iranian ethnolinguistic group indigenous to southern and eastern Afghanistan and northwestern Pakistan. They are an Diaspora people, in the Pashtun people cluster of the Persian-Median affinity bloc. Their primary religion is Islam - Sunni. They primarily speak Pashto, Northern.
